Small wireless sensors installed in rooms, fridges, freezers and storage areas. These sensors check temperatures every 30 minutes, day and night. If any temperature moves outside safe ranges, the system sends immediate alerts to designated staff members by text and email. This catches problems before incidents occur. The system stores all temperature records automatically, creating a complete digital record for EHO inspections.

When sensors detect unsafe temperatures, the system takes three immediate actions. First, it sends alerts to designated staff members. Second, it logs the incident and starts tracking how long the temperature remains out of range. Third, it provides step-by-step guidance for staff to resolve the issue. The system maintains records of the incident, actions taken, and resolution time for compliance purposes.
